我想提示用户输入,让用户输入多行文本,在每行之间输入,然后按CTRL + D或其他类似的东西终止输入.
使用"按键",我可以捕获EOF,但我必须手动处理所有回声,退格处理,终端转义序列等.如果我可以使用"readline",但以某种方式用"按键"拦截CTRL + D(EOF)会好得多,但我不确定我会怎么做.
keypress readline command-line-interface eof node.js
command-line-interface ×1
eof ×1
keypress ×1
node.js ×1
readline ×1